首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

HTML select在AJAX调用后不起作用

可能是因为在AJAX请求返回后,没有正确更新select元素的选项列表。这可能是由于以下几个原因导致的:

  1. 数据未正确加载:在AJAX请求返回后,需要确保获取到了正确的数据。可以通过在AJAX请求的回调函数中检查返回的数据是否为空来确认。
  2. 选项列表未更新:一旦获取到了正确的数据,需要将其用于更新select元素的选项列表。可以通过遍历数据并创建新的option元素,然后将其添加到select元素中来实现。
  3. 事件绑定问题:如果在select元素的选项列表更新后,仍然无法选择选项,可能是因为事件绑定出现了问题。可以尝试重新绑定change事件,确保选择选项后能够触发相应的操作。
  4. 其他可能的问题:还有一些其他可能导致select元素不起作用的问题,例如CSS样式冲突、JavaScript错误等。可以通过检查浏览器的开发者工具中的控制台输出来查找潜在的错误信息。

针对这个问题,腾讯云提供了一系列相关产品和服务,可以帮助解决云计算中的各种问题。例如,腾讯云的云服务器(CVM)提供了稳定可靠的服务器运维环境,腾讯云的云数据库(TencentDB)提供了高性能的数据库服务,腾讯云的云原生应用平台(TKE)提供了便捷的容器化部署和管理解决方案等。具体的产品介绍和链接地址可以参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Vue 学习笔记 —— 常用特性 (二)

用后台的方法 console.log(this.hobby); } } }) script> 2.5 select 下拉框处理 2.5.1 选择一条数据 下拉框选择一条值的时候和单选框的情况是一样的...调用后台的方法 console.log(this.project); } } }) script> 2.5.2 select 选择多条数据 我们 select 中加一条属性...lazy:将 input 事件转换为 change 事件 2.7.1 number 类型 一般情况 JavaScript 中计算的都是 字符串拼接,如果我们要进行数值类型计算,就要使用类型转换 5.2 侦听器小实例,用户验证小 demo 侦听器的使用情景一般 ajax 验证用的比较多,接下来我们就以一个简单的用户验证为例演示 watch 的使用场景。...'; } } }) script> body> html> 六、过滤器(filters) 6.1 过滤器的基本使用 首先,我们需要自定义一个过滤规则,然后插值表达式中

4.8K20

第三方登录(2)---GitHub登录

login.html放置一个GitHub登录按钮,点击登录按钮重定向到https://github.com/login/oauth/authorize进行授权。...我们可以看到,我们授权界面成功登录后会回调到我们的回界面,并附加code参数。我们需要取到url中code,然后开始第二步操作。...我们可以看到调用后端接口能否成功获取到access_token. ?...前端第一步获取到code之后,发起ajax请求后端获取access_token,并且打印access_token的值,我们浏览器端测试看看是否有效果。 ?...可以看到我们成功获取到用户个人信息,最后前端发起ajax请求调用后端的获取用户信息接口 ? 我们发起ajax请求后端获取用户数据的接口,然后获取到用户数据后直接在界面显示出来。

1.7K20

第三方登录(3)---微博登录

html标签加入xml命名空间 ? head标签中引入wb.js ? 需要部署微博关注按钮的位置粘贴一下代码 ? 我们可以看下效果 ? 可以看到最上面有一个加关注按钮。...前端获取到code传给后端获取access_token与uid; 3.根据access_token与uid获取用户信息保存到数据库并并返回用户信息给前端; 授权并获取code 首先,我们登录界面login.html...我们可以看到,我们授权界面成功登录后会回调到我们的回界面,并附加code参数。我们需要取到url中code,然后开始第二步操作。...前端第一步获取到code之后,发起ajax请求后端获取access_token,并且打印access_token的值,我们浏览器端测试看看是否有效果。 ?...可以看到我们成功获取到用户个人信息,最后前端发起ajax请求调用后端的获取用户信息接口。 ? 我们发起ajax请求后端获取用户数据的接口,然后获取到用户数据后直接在界面显示出来。

5.1K31

AJAX

AJAX 最大的优点是不重新加载整个页面的情况下,可以与服务器交换数据并更新部分网页内容。 AJAX 不需要任何浏览器插件,但需要用户允许JavaScript浏览器上执行。...4.监听服务器发送回的响应 AJAX实现过程 1.一个简单的html页面 <!...('ajax回复') 6.注意事项 1.监听函数xmlHttp.onreadystatechange必须要放在xmlHttp对象创建之后,中间不能有其他内容,否则xmlHttp对象就像是不起作用了一样,...,type表示要从服务器端收到的数据类型,有text|html|json|script,规定了返回数据的类型后,如果服务器发送的不是这种类型,那么不会执行回函数 将上一节中的func函数改为如下 function...context 类型:Object 让回函数内 this 指向这个对象,比如document.body,那么函数中,$(this)就是这个对象 data 类型为字典Key/Value格式,发送到服务器的数据

4.2K20

你真的知道ajax的全部吗?

但是,函数方面,jQuery的功能非常弱。为了改变这一点,jQuery开发团队就设计了deferred对象。 简单说,deferred对象就是jQuery的回函数解决方案。...二、ajax操作的链式写法 jQuery的ajax操作,传统写法是这样的:   $.ajax({     url: "test.html",     success: function(){...请看下面的代码,它用到了一个新的方法$.when(): $.when($.ajax("test1.html"), $.ajax("test2.html"))   .done(function(){ alert...; }); (运行代码示例4) 这段代码的意思是,先执行两个操作$.ajax("test1.html")和$.ajax("test2.html"),如果成功了,就运行done()指定的回函数;...$.ajax( "test.html" )   .always( function() { alert("已执行!");} );

96670

第113天:Ajax跨域请求解决方法

} 11 } 12 ajax.open("GET","h51701.json",true); 13 ajax.send(null); 二、ajax的跨域请求 [跨域请求处理]由于JS中存在同源策略。...ajax请求时,设置dataType为"json"  ② 后台返回时,依然需要返回回函数。...但是,ajax发送请求时会默认使用get请求将回到函数名发给后台,后台可以使用$_GET['callback']取出回函数名: echo "{$_GET['callback']}({$str})"...; ③ 后台返回以后,ajax依然可以用success作为成功的回函数: success:function(data){} 当然后台也可以随便返回一个回函数名。...方法调用后端的Web服务GetSingleInfo方法,后台的GetSingleInfo方法,使用前端的回方法OnGetMemberSuccessByjsonp包装后台的业务操作的JSON对象,返回给前端一段

1.4K10

基于layUI调用后台数据实现区域信息级联查询

1.基本思路后台提供根据区域编码查询区域列表公共接口页面初始化调用后台接口加载所有省份点击省份将省份区域编码传入后台查询该省份下所有地市信息,以此类推4.后端接口实现我这里以Java实现的,单表查询就不贴具体代码了...').html('');            $('#js-select-county').html('');            $('#js-select-street').html('');            ...$('#js-select-village').html('');            var cityHtml = '请选择'            ...').html('');            $('#js-select-street').html('');            $('#js-select-village').html('');...').html('');            $('#js-select-village').html('');            var streetHtml = '<option value=

1.1K30

Spring学习笔记(二十三)——实现网站微信扫码登录获取微信用户信息Demo

微信扫码登录介绍 微信扫码登录是指微信OAuth3.0授权登录让微信用户使用微信身份安全登录第三方应用或网站,微信用户授权登录已接入微信OAuth3.0的第三方应用后,第三方可以获取到用户的接口调用凭证...开发步骤 第三方发起微信授权登录请求,微信用户允许授权第三方应用后,微信会拉起应用或重定向到第三方网站,并且带上授权临时票据code参数; 通过code参数加上AppID和AppSecret等,通过API...官网中有使用场景案例和功能介绍,可以自行查看 其中官网中最重要的一个东西:就是API文档啦 API文档:http://login.vicy.cn/apiWord.html 里面的介绍也比较详细,不过第一次使用也会有写困难...开发步骤 首先使用微信登录码上登录官网,注册账号 然后就可以直接创建应用了 填写回url的时候必须填写已备案域名的回地址(下面细说) 接着打开API文档,试着请求接口请求地址:https:...是被回的,第三方码上登录回 */ @RequestMapping("/loginService") @ResponseBody public

2.2K21

如何配置ajax请求跨域携带cookie,cors支持ajax请求携带cookie

首先咱们来看一下前后端数据交互的一些规则: 1、同域名下发送ajax请求,请求中默认会携带cookie 2、ajax发送跨域请求时,默认情况下是不会携带cookie的 3、ajax发送跨域请求时如果想携带...此时cookie又回来了,到此为止前端人员的设置就算完成了,虽然现在ajax执行后,最终调用的是错误回,那是因为后端还不支持cors。...但是ajax用后执行的还是错误回,并且console面板打印了一个错误: ?...响应头中Access-Control-Allow-Origin的值设置成了白名单,但是等等,此时为什么ajax用后,还是执行错误毁掉呢?...查看响应头多了一个Access-Control-Allow-Credentials:true,此时ajax的回终于是成功回调了。

16.5K31
领券